[QUOTE="verybrad, post: 3738440, member: 37"]Hydrocal is heavy. Just not as hard or durable as concrete. Also does not weather well if untreated. The bubbles seen are more typical of hydrocal than concrete. Also the way it has taken stain is more typical of hydrocal. If hydrocal, you should be able to cut into the bottom fairly easily with a knife.[/QUOTE]
